Solicitor Prices in Woodstock

Service Typical Cost Unit
House purchase conveyancing (uncontested) £1200 – £2200 per transaction
Hourly legal consultation and advice £200 – £350 per hour
Will writing and simple estate planning £300 – £600 per will
Probate and estate administration £1500 – £4000 per estate
Family law matters (divorce initial advice) £250 – £450 per consultation
Business contract drafting and review £500 – £1500 per contract
Employment law representation £180 – £350 per hour
Leasehold extension or enfranchisement £1800 – £3500 per case

Prices are indicative averages for Woodstock. Actual quotes will vary based on job specifics.

What Affects the Cost?

Solicitor costs in Woodstock are influenced by several key factors: the complexity and specialisation required (probate and family law typically cost more than straightforward conveyancing), the solicitor's seniority and expertise level, whether you pay hourly rates or a fixed fee, and local demand for services in this affluent area. Property transactions near Woodstock and Oxford command premium fees due to higher property values. Urgent matters, contentious work, and cases requiring expert witnesses will increase costs significantly. Additional disbursements such as court fees, Land Registry charges, and searches are charged separately.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why do Woodstock solicitor fees cost more than other areas?
Woodstock is in the South East region with higher property values and cost of living. Solicitors here typically charge 20–30% more than national averages. Proximity to Oxford and the affluent Cotswolds client base also drives premium pricing compared to rural or northern areas.
Are solicitor fees fixed or negotiable?
Many solicitors offer fixed fees for routine work like conveyancing and will writing, making costs predictable. For more complex matters (divorce, litigation), hourly rates apply. Always discuss and agree fees in writing before instructing a solicitor. Some firms may negotiate, especially for larger or bundled matters.
What is included in a conveyancing fee?
A typical conveyancing fee covers legal advice, document preparation, searches (local authority, environmental), and Land Registry registration. Disbursements—such as survey fees, mortgage discharge, and searches—are charged separately. Always ask for a detailed breakdown of included and additional costs.
Can I pay solicitor fees in instalments?
Many Woodstock solicitors offer payment plans for substantial matters like probate or contentious family work. This may incur a small additional charge. Discuss payment options when obtaining your initial quote to spread costs over the matter's duration.
